What preventive maintenance do you recommend to avoid costly repairs?

Regular maintenance extends system life and reduces emergency repairs. Key actions include annual water heater servicing and draining, seasonal boiler or furnace tune-ups, periodic pipe inspections for corrosion, and routine drain cleaning. We offer maintenance agreements to keep schedules on track.

What should I do if I notice a gas smell or suspect a carbon monoxide issue?

If you smell gas, evacuate the premises immediately, avoid using electrical switches or open flames, and call FortisBC emergency services and our office. For carbon monoxide concerns, leave the building, seek fresh air, and call emergency services. We provide diagnostic testing and safe repairs for gas appliances and ventilation systems.
